Because 10% of all physician visits are related to illnesses that involve skin symptoms, every health care professional must be able to recognize medical problems of the skin. This book has long been the most widely-used resource for that purpose.
This best-selling book reflects the "tried and true" format of the Color Atlas and Synopsis series: for each condition, there are one to two color photographs coupled with salient points of epidemiology, history, physical exam, differential diagnosis, laboratory and special examinations, disease course and up-to-date treatments. Brief overviews of pathogenesis are given in special boxed elements that include icons that identify the illness as rare, not so common, or common and low morbidity, considerable morbidity, and serious.
In contrast to the other dermatology references, this is a quick-reference clinical guide. It provides synoptic content in the need-to-know areas of information that physicians want to access during clinical care.
